El 27 de marzo de 2013 17:24, Arcel Labrada Batista <alabra...@uci.cu> escribió:
>
>
> buenas tardes,
> necesito algún documento con consultas utiles al catalogo de postgres para 
> tenerlo, y por si no existe necesito de manera un poco mas urgente una 
> consulta que me devuelva algo como lo siguiente
>
> nombre_tabla    columnas
> mitabla_1           col1t1,col2t1,col3t1
> mitabla_2           col1t2,col2t2,col3t2
>
>
> donde col1t1,col2t1,col3t1  son las columnas de mitabla_1, gracias de antemano
>
>

SELECT c.relname AS tabla, array_agg(a.attname) AS columnas
FROM pg_catalog.pg_attribute a JOIN pg_catalog.pg_class c ON a.attrelid =  c.oid
WHERE c.relname ~ '^(auditoria)$' AND a.attnum > 0 AND NOT a.attisdropped
GROUP BY c.relname;
   tabla   |                 columnas
-----------+------------------------------------------
 auditoria | {codigo,tipo,ident,exito,ts,descripcion}


--
Martín Marqués
select 'martin.marques' || '@' || 'gmail.com'
DBA, Programador, Administrador

-
Enviado a la lista de correo pgsql-es-ayuda (pgsql-es-ayuda@postgresql.org)
Para cambiar tu suscripci�n:
http://www.postgresql.org/mailpref/pgsql-es-ayuda

Responder a